Quick answer

Arranging n distinct people in a circle gives (n − 1)! arrangements because rotating everyone one seat does not create a new arrangement.

circular permutations = (n − 1)!

Why (n − 1)! and not n!?

Fix one person as a reference point; everyone else arranges around them in (n − 1)! ways, since rotating the whole table changes nothing.

When do reflections matter?

For physical objects you can flip — a bracelet — but not for a dinner table, where left and right differ.
